DWI Clients - Alcohol and Drug Rehabilitation Centers - Monona, IA.

DWI clients in treatment need to complete specific requirements to fulfill the conditions of their court sentencing. Rehab programs that help satisfy these demands and conditions, which are typically more lenient than regular sentencing such as large fines and jail time, are available in Monona to deliver educational services, therapy, and further evaluation for severe alcohol or drug issues.

Education is an essential treatment tool used at rehab programs catering to DWI offenders. There are various levels of alcohol education classes which can differ by state. Level I education typically consist of 12 hours of group education related to the effects of drugs and/or alcohol. This is the what a person with a single offense or someone under the age of 21 will usually be required to do. Level II courses would include both substance abuse education and therapy at a program which is approved by the courts. How long a person will need to participate in therapy depends on certain considerations, which can include how many DWI's the person has had, and the severity of the offense. In most cases, clients will be required to take the Level II DWI classes and therapy unless their blood-alcohol level was extremely low when they were stopped and there weren't any other significant infractions when the offender was arrested.
